Measuring Tools

Accurate measurement is key in baking. Even slight deviations can affect the outcome, so investing in precise measuring tools is beneficial.

  • Measuring Cups and Spoons: Look for sets with clear markings and sturdy handles. Stainless steel is durable, while plastic is lightweight.

  • Kitchen Scale: A digital kitchen scale can offer precision that cups and spoons can't always provide. Especially useful when dealing with recipes from different parts of the world that use weight measurements.

Mixing Equipment

Mixing ingredients properly ensures that your cupcakes turn out fluffy and well-textured.

  • Mixing Bowls: Having a variety of sizes can be helpful. Stainless steel, glass, or ceramic bowls are popular choices because they're versatile and easy to clean.

  • Hand Mixer or Stand Mixer: A hand mixer is great for quick tasks, while a stand mixer is invaluable for larger batches or stiffer doughs. Brands such as KitchenAid and Cuisinart have been highly regarded by home bakers.

Baking Tools

These tools help with the process of preparing your cupcakes for the oven.

  • Spatulas and Whisks: Silicone spatulas are heat-resistant and flexible, useful for scraping bowls clean. Whisks help in combining ingredients smoothly.

  • Ice Cream Scoop: An ice cream scoop helps in portioning batter evenly into cupcake liners, ensuring each cupcake bakes consistently.

Baking Pans and Liners

Selecting the right pans and liners reflects on the appearance and ease of removal for your cupcakes.

  • Muffin Tins: Most cupcake recipes call for 12-cup muffin tins. Nonstick tins can prevent sticking, but a light greasing or use of liners is often still recommended.

  • Cupcake Liners: Available in many colors and patterns, allowing some creativity. Parchment paper liners are a good eco-friendly option.

Baking and Decoration

For the final touches, these tools bring your cupcakes to life.

  • Cooling Rack: Allows for even cooling of cupcakes, preventing them from becoming soggy in the pan.

  • Piping Bags and Tips: Essential if you wish to decorate your cupcakes with frosting beautifully. Start with basic tips like star and round tips – easy for beginners to use and create attractive designs.

  • Offset Spatula: Handy for spreading frosting smoothly. Its angled blade helps to maneuver around the cupcake effectively.

Oven Thermometer

One last important tool is an oven thermometer. Not all ovens are perfectly accurate. Placing a thermometer allows you to adjust your oven settings accordingly to ensure your cupcakes bake just right.
